Ashok Leyland has submitted to the exchanges the Secretarial Audit Report of its material subsidiary Hinduja Leyland Finance Limited (HLFL) for the financial year ended March 31, 2025, as required under SEBI Listing Regulations. The report is clean — it contains no qualifications, reservations, adverse remarks, or disclaimers, and was placed before HLFL's Board on August 5, 2025. Key items disclosed in the report include a Rs. 100 crore preferential equity allotment to Ashok Leyland (1 crore shares at Rs. 200 each), ESOP allotments of 82,000 shares, and total NCD issuances aggregating roughly Rs. 2,459 crores (secured, perpetual, and redeemable non-convertible debentures). Board changes included the re-appointment of Mr. Sachin Pillai as Managing Director, and the appointment of Mr. Jose Maria Alapont as Independent Director.
